What Types of Work and Facilities Can Outpatient Physical Therapists Expect in Tacoma, WA?

As a Physical Therapist specializing in outpatient care in Tacoma, Washington, you can expect to work in a variety of dynamic settings that cater to diverse patient populations, including private outpatient clinics, rehabilitation centers, sports medicine facilities, and wellness centers. In these environments, you will have the opportunity to provide personalized rehabilitation plans for patients recovering from injuries, surgeries, or chronic pain conditions. Your role will often involve collaborating with interdisciplinary teams to enhance patient outcomes, utilizing advanced modalities and evidence-based practices to promote mobility and functional independence. Additionally, Tacoma’s proximity to various healthcare networks allows for potential engagements in community outreach programs and educational workshops, fostering a holistic approach to health and wellness. With a strong emphasis on patient care and innovation, Tacoma offers a vibrant landscape for Physical Therapists seeking to make a impactful difference in the lives of individuals in their community.

Why Should Outpatient Physical Therapists Consider Working in Tacoma, Washington

As a travel job opportunity with AMN Healthcare, working as an Outpatient Physical Therapist in Tacoma, Washington, offers a unique blend of professional growth and quality of life. Tacoma is celebrated for its stunning waterfront views, rich cultural scene, and proximity to the breathtaking landscapes of the Pacific Northwest, making it an ideal location for outdoor enthusiasts and city dwellers alike. The weather is generally mild, with the region experiencing a temperate maritime climate, providing comfortable summers and cool, wet winters which enhance the lush scenery. Popular neighborhoods like the vibrant University Place and the historic Stadium District offer diverse housing options and a welcoming community atmosphere. In your downtime, you can explore local attractions such as the Museum of Glass, Point Defiance Park, and delicious eateries at the Tacoma Waterfront, ensuring that you have a balanced lifestyle that every healthcare professional deserves. Similar Cities to Tacoma, Washington, for Outpatient Physical Therapists: Opportunities, Lifestyle, and Pay Comparisons

One city that shares similarities with Tacoma, Washington for outpatient physical therapists is Portland, Oregon. Known for its vibrant culture and laid-back lifestyle, Portland offers a comparable climate with mild, wet winters and warm, dry summers reminiscent of Tacoma. The salary for physical therapists in Portland is typically on par with that of Tacoma, allowing for a comfortable living. The cost of living has been rising but generally remains manageable compared to cities like San Francisco or New York. Residents enjoy diverse housing options, from urban apartments to suburban homes, and have access to beautiful parks and numerous outdoor activities.

Another city that aligns closely with Tacoma’s characteristics is Spokane, Washington. Spokane’s cost of living is notably lower than that of Tacoma, making it an attractive option for physical therapists looking for affordable housing and a relaxed ambiance. Salaries for outpatient physical therapists in Spokane are slightly lower but still competitive, with a growing healthcare sector that provides various job opportunities. The city boasts a variety of recreational activities, from hiking and biking to numerous cultural events, ensuring an engaging lifestyle while maintaining a friendly small-town feel.

Cincinnati, Ohio, presents a different regional perspective while offering many comparable features to Tacoma. The city’s cost of living is significantly lower, making housing options highly affordable compared to Tacoma. In terms of salary, outpatient physical therapists can expect slightly lower pay, but this is offset by the low living expenses. Cincinnati has a rich arts scene, beautiful parks, and a burgeoning culinary landscape, offering ample leisure options that contribute to a balanced lifestyle. The temperate climate includes hot summers and cold winters, adding to the city’s overall appeal for those who enjoy varied seasonal experiences.
